Lewis-Palmer D-38 to close schools Tuesday after threat
Lewis-Palmer District 38 announced on Monday afternoon that all of its schools will be closed on Tuesday “out of an abundance of caution.” In a statement sent out to district families and staff, D-38 communications director Amy Matisek said that law enforcement informed administration of a potential risk involving Monument-area schools. “We understand this is…

Woodland Park School District reports decline in enrollment
The Woodland Park School District RE-2 school board received an update on its student enrollment during its regular meeting on Nov. 12. An October count of 1,884 students saw enrollment drop from the previous year’s total of 2,015 reported by the Colorado Department of Education. These totals reflect full-time and part-time students in the district.…

‘It’s definitely painful’: One of Colorado’s oldest charter schools is closing
GLOBE Charter School, one of Colorado’s oldest charter schools, will close its doors upon the conclusion of the 2023-24 schoolyear.
